<sub dropzone="8riospg"></sub><noscript dropzone="g7wooq2"></noscript>

网页获取 TPWallet 地址的实务指南:从便捷支付到代币更新的全链路解析

本文聚焦网页如何获取 TPWallet 地址,以及在前端与后端协同中的安全、便捷实现。下面从技术路径、用户体验、合规与安全、以及经济设计四大维度展开。\n\n一、目标与前提\n在网页应用中获取用户的 TPWallet 地址,首要目标是实现快速、可控、尊重用户隐私的地址披露流程。常用的实现路径包括 WalletConnect(或 TPWallet 的本地深链接)等跨钱包协作协议。用户授权后,前端可获得账户地址与网络信息,用于后续的支付、签名和查询。核心原则是最小权限、获取前端可验证的地址、避免将私钥暴露在浏览端。\n\n二、获取 TPWallet 地址的实现路径与注意事项\n1) 引导式连接:在页面提供“连接钱包”按钮,用户选择 TPWallet,触发 WalletConnect 会话请求;2) 授权与会话建立:用户在 TPWallet 中确认会话,前端接收 session 对象,包含 accounts 与 chainId;3) 地址处理:从 session.accounts 提取地

址,推荐对地址格式进行标准化(如以太坊类型地址),并绑定当前网络。4) 安全要点:使用只读的地址用作显示与调用,不请求不必要的权限;对返回的地址执行白名单校验,防止误导性请求;对用户可撤销的会话设定超时。\n\n三、便捷支付应用的场景与实现要点\n便捷支付场景包含:商户网页支付、跨域金额校验、再次确认与支付状态回调。实现要点包括:1) 生成支付请求时对金额、货币、到期时间进行签名并通过前端请求 TPWallet 发起转账;2) 支持 ERC-20/BEP-20 等代币标准的授权与转账;3) 使用 QR 码或深链接实现无缝支付;4) 提供交易状态回调接口,确保商户端 UI 的一致性与幂等性。\n\n四、合约验证的基本方法与最佳实践\n合约验证不仅是安全审阅,也包括对源代码、编译器版本、优化设置的公开验真。建议步骤:1) 将合约源代码提交到区块浏览器的验证平台,附上 ABI、编译器版本与优化设置;2) 对比字节码与源代码,以确保透明度;3) 对关键函数实现进行静态/动态审计,记录版本号、发布时间;4) 对升级路径进行备案,避免恶意合约替换。\n\n五、专业解答报告与风控\n针对用

户问答与风险评估,模板通常包含:安全性综述、权限控制、隐私保护、合规性要点、交易失败风险、操作建议。专业报告应覆盖:身份校验、最小权限原则、日志留存、数据最小化、应急预案、漏洞披露路径。通过可解释的答疑,降低用户误解与安全隐患。\n\n六、智能商业管理与通货紧缩、代币更新设计\n智能商业管理场景通过对链上数据的聚合分析,提升运营效率、库存管理与支付体验。对通货紧缩的设计,宜在代币模型中设置燃烧、销毁机制或限量发行的上限,并确保会话层面的透明度。代币更新方面,推荐准备代理合约或升级方案,确保迁移计划清晰、用户通知到位、回滚机制完备;在升级前进行多阶段测试与版本控制,避免对现有商户与用户造成冲击。最后,结合链上治理与链下运营,构建可持续的代币经济模型。

作者:Nova Chen发布时间:2025-09-23 06:39:03

评论

TechGuru88

很实用的指南,尤其是关于 WalletConnect 的实现细节,帮助我理解前端集成的关键点。

李海

文章把合约验证讲得清楚,实操性强,值得新手和开发者参考。

CryptoWiz

对代币更新与通货紧缩的部分很有启发,提醒我在设计经济模型时要考虑长期影响。

Sunny花

把便捷支付应用落地的案例讲得好,有具体的实现思路和安全注意事项。

WalletWatcher

提供了完整的从地址获取到交易执行的流程图思路,非常清晰。

相关阅读